Water Polo Live Stream - News Corp Partnership

Water Polo Australia (WPA) and News Corp Australia will partner in a new national broadcast streaming deal that is set to bring over 200 water polo games live between January and May 2022. 

UQ Affiliation Update

Previously, we voted for the Barracudas to affiliate with the University of Queensland and I am pleased to announce that we are to see this officially take place in the coming weeks with a change in our club's name and branding across uniforms, website and social platforms. The merge aligns us to the University of Queensland as one of their affiliate clubs. This will see us change our name to the University of Queensland Water Polo Club.

Water Polo Queensland - A Grade Competition Structure

The Southeast Queensland A-Grade Competition, as part of the BWPI summer competitions, will offer a second-tier competition for those aspiring to compete in the Premier League. It will also provide participating Clubs/Associations the opportunity to develop potential talent for the Premier League. In the future, it is likely that the A-Grade Competition will see the formation of a promotion and relegation format, which will see Premier League and A-Grade teams vying to remain in the Premier Comp
